 What the Course Entails and Exam Details

This practice exam isn't a single course, but rather a set of dynamic tools designed to mirror the actual certification exam's structure and content. The final certification exam assesses competence across key domains. For OTR candidates, these include Evaluation and Assessment, Analysis and Interpretation, Intervention Planning, and Competence in Intervention and Professional Practice. For COTA candidates, focus areas are Assisting with Evaluation and Assessment, Intervention Implementation, and Professional Practice.  What to Expect in the Final Exam

The final NBCOT certification exam is a rigorous four-hour computer-adaptive test (CAT). Candidates should expect 170 to 200 items, which are a combination of multiple-choice questions and clinical scenarios. OTR candidates will also encounter unique Clinical Simulation Problems (CSP). The required passing scaled score is 450, on a scale ranging from 300 to 600. Strict exam-day rules are in place, including no outside materials, to ensure the integrity of the results.



 How to Study and Exam Centers

Mastering the material requires a proactive and diverse approach. Take full advantage of official NBCOT practice exams and third-party prep resources to build stamina with timed simulations, identify weaker knowledge areas, and refine your clinical reasoning. Focus on understanding the 'why' behind correct answers, with safety and client-centered care always as your top priority. Textbooks remain a crucial foundation for deep understanding. The actual certification exam is administered through authorized Pearson VUE testing centers. Students can schedule their exam at a convenient, proctored physical location across the globe, while the practice exams are generally available through online platforms.
